Moving to Orange is roughly financially neutral — costs and incomes shift together.
Orange has a cost index of 162 vs 111 for Vancouver. Orange is 51 points more expensive overall. Monthly rent goes from $1,769 to $3,200 (+81%).
If you earn the Vancouver median of $78,156, you would need approximately $114,066/year in Orange to maintain equivalent purchasing power, based on the cost index difference of 51 points (46%).
Median rent in Vancouver is $1,769/month. In Orange it is $3,200/month — a difference of +$1,431 per month, or $17,172 per year.
